How guest reviews work
Each review score is between 1-10. To get the overall score that you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of review scores we’ve received. We use a weighted review system which means that the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. In addition, guests can give separate ‘subscores’ in crucial areas, such as location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value for money and free Wi-Fi. Note that guests submit their subscores and their over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.
You can review an Accommodation that you booked through our Platform if you stayed there or if you arrived at the property but didn’t actually stay there. To edit a review you’ve already submitted, please contact our Customer Service team.
We have people and automated systems that specialise in detecting fake reviews submitted to our Platform. If we find any, we delete them and, if necessary, take action against whoever is responsible.
Anyone else who spots something suspicious can always report it to our Customer Service team, so our Fraud team can investigate.
Ideally, we would publish every review we receive, whether positive or negative. However, we won’t display any review that includes or refers to (among other things):

Verified reviewThis is a lovely quirky place and we loved the space and the veranda. Staff were super friendly and great choice of breakfasts available to buy. Our room was a good size with a nice veranda to relax on, or watch the fish below. The location is good for ease of water taxi transport, pick up for excursions and a short stroll to a couple of nice bars, and there was always something to watch. The hotel had an honesty bar which was a nice touch.
The location's downfall is that there is a lot of noise especially at night as it's directly opposite Bocas town. Thank goodness for the white noise app provided which helped us sleep. In hindsight, the transfer we booked via the hotel to collect us from the airport was expensive - we'd have been better just arranging this ourselves.

Verified reviewMy family and I stayed in six different hotels across Panama over a two week period and the consensus at the end was that Casa Acuario was the favourite. And by quite a distance. First of all, it’s just a cool place to stay. On stilts, over clear warm water, perfect for the kids (and adults) to snorkel, we got to see shawls of small fish along with a few big ones and the odd ray within seconds of our arrival. We were a two minute boat-taxi away from Bocas town and its modest number of good bars and restaurants, but staying at Casa Acuario meant we got the peace and quiet which the mainland didn’t look like it easily provided. The room we were in (upstairs) was easily big enough for two adults and the kids (aged 13 and 10), nicely decorated and with really comfortable beds and a hammock from which you could overlook the sea. As dog lovers, my children were over the moon that there were three (clean, friendly and well behaved) dogs on site. There were a couple of good places to eat and drink on the small island which we could get to on foot from Casa Acuario, and a nice beach about 15mins walk from the hotel. The fridge full of beer on the decking was also a nice touch! But alongside all of these positives, the main thing that gave Casa Acuario the ‘X Factor’ were the owners, Mandy and JP. We were made to feel welcome from minute one, they could not have been more helpful and they made a real impression on the whole family in our three days with them. And just to provide a little context, after Casa Acuario were went to the nearby, and much more expensive, Eclypse de Mar Acqua Lodge for two nights which, before arriving, I thought was going to be the highlight of the Bocas itinerary. Take nothing away from The Eclypse which was seriously nice, but I wish I’d stayed at Casa Acuario for the full duration. Verified reviewJP & Mandy are incredible hosts. Breakfast was great. Always friendly, attentive, helpful service. Room was very clean and comfortable. Great sunset views. Even had a mini-fridge, hot plate and microwave so you could cook your own meals. Short, $1 water taxi ride to Bocas Town where there are more restaurants.
The property is located across from Bocas Town and at night there is loud music across the water. Also, for 16 hours a day water taxi's fly through the channel in front of the hotel. Mandy and JP do the best they can with noise machines to cover the noise, but strongly recommend ear plugs. Mandy is working to get the town to enforce their noise ordinance.
